Contaminated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Water damage from a burst pipe Yes Yes Professional equipment and expertise required for safe and effective removal.
Contaminated water in a crawl space No Yes Specialized equipment and safety gear required to prevent exposure to contaminants.
Water stains on walls or ceilings No Yes Professional inspection and diagnosis required to find out extent of damage and recommend necessary repairs.
Unexplained health issues No Yes Professional inspection and testing required to find out source of contamination and recommend necessary remediation.
Water damage from a natural disaster No Yes Professional equipment and expertise required for safe and effective removal and repair.
Contaminated water in a small area Yes No DIY removal and cleaning may be enough for small areas, but always follow safety guidelines and use proper equipment.

Contaminated Water Removal Cost in Midpines, CA

The cost of contaminated water removal in Midpines, CA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on typical price ranges and may vary depending on the specifics of your situation. Call us today for a free assessment. We’ll provide a customized estimate for your specific needs. Our team is here to help.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Water Removal $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Final Inspection and Testing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
